Tim Mooney, partner in Silver Bullet LLC and pioneer of the signature bluff strategy, brought an idea into the limelight about lobbyists being a threat to the I&R process at the Global Forum. Mainstream I&R activists have always focused in on state officials being the biggest concern.

His explanation was that lobbyists who engage in social activity with the legislatures are able to do just as much as, if not more than, initiative & veto referendum petitions.
